The overarching consensus models this asset as a premier distribution monopoly navigating a temporary stagflationary vise. While the core professional contractor network remains highly insulated from technological disruption, the near-term outlook is constrained by a dual-front macro headwind: a frozen housing transaction market driven by restrictive monetary policy, and acute petrochemical input cost inflation stemming from geopolitical supply-chain blockades. The base-case thesis projects a necessary multiple contraction from premium levels toward historical averages as near-term margin compression snaps the market's priced-for-perfection expectations. However, the company's elite free cash flow conversion and disciplined capital allocation will act as a structural cushion, driving long-term compounding once input costs normalize and the housing market thaws.
